Powis Castle in Welshpool is famous for its peacocks and now it wants your help in naming its latest arrivals.
Two male peacocks arrived at the National Trust property in November.
Powis Castle said: "You’ve met Alan and Perry and we know the name Alan raised a few eyebrows (or ruffled a few feathers), so we’d love to see your suggestions for what we should call these two. Any ideas?"
